Patents Assigned to Fanhattan LLC
  • Publication number: 20140310600
    Abstract: A first display comprising a first live media content of a first media channel is generated. Input data are detected from a touch-enabled surface. A second display is caused to traverse over the first display in response to the input data. The second display, during traverse, comprises a description of a second live media content of a second media channel and a background picture of the second live media content. The second live media content of the second media channel is generated in the second display.
    Type: Application
    Filed: April 12, 2013
    Publication date: October 16, 2014
    Applicant: Fanhattan LLC
    Inventors: Gilles Serge BianRosa, Olivier Chalouhi, Gregory Smelzer
  • Patent number: 8842131
    Abstract: A method and system for framework clipping are disclosed. A user interface tree of widgets corresponding to widgets requiring clipping is traversed. For each encountered widget, layer allocation operations are performed which include selecting a current, previous, or next layer to which to allocate the widget and determining whether the selected layer can accommodate the widget, where a determination that the selected layer cannot accommodate the widget results in a bit from a stencil buffer being allocated to the selected layer. A value of the selected layer is incremented to account for the widget being allocated to the selected layer A stencil test mask is generated as a combination of value of the layers previous to a current layer. The stencil test mask is written to the stencil buffer, and the layer allocation operations are repeated for each remaining widget.
    Type: Grant
    Filed: January 10, 2012
    Date of Patent: September 23, 2014
    Assignee: Fanhattan LLC
    Inventor: Olivier Chalouhi
  • Patent number: 8719866
    Abstract: In a method and system for accessing content, a selection of a media content item having at least one set of episodes is received. Each of the at least one set of episodes is displayed as a user-selectable element in a user interface. A selection of a user-selectable element corresponding to a set of the at least one set of episodes is received. The display of the selected user-selectable element is expanded to display the episodes of the set within the selected user-selectable element, with each episode of the episodes of the set being represented by an additional user-selectable element. A selection of an episode from the set of episodes is received. At least one content source from which the selected episode is available to be retrieved is displayed. A content source of the at least one content source from which the selected episode is to be retrieved is received.
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: May 6, 2014
    Assignee: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Christophe Jean-Claude Gillet, Keith Ohlfs
  • Publication number: 20140082497
    Abstract: A system and method for providing a user interface for live media content is described. A top portion of the user interface is populated with media content categories. A selection of a media content category from the media content categories is received. A bottom portion of the user interface is populated with at least one panel relating to the selection of media content category. A timeline comprising a progress indicator corresponding to a progress of a live media content associated with the at least one panel is generated in the user interface.
    Type: Application
    Filed: September 17, 2013
    Publication date: March 20, 2014
    Applicant: Fanhattan LLC
    Inventors: Olivier Chalouhi, Gilles Serge BianRosa, Nicolas Paton, William Jiang
  • Publication number: 20130176243
    Abstract: A remote control device comprises a housing cover configured to mate with a touch-enabled surface configured to receive input gestures, and a battery holder disposed between the housing cover and the touch-enabled surface. A first plurality of magnets is disposed in the housing cover. A second plurality of magnets is disposed in the battery holder. The first plurality of magnets in the housing cover is attracted to the second plurality of magnets in a first position of the housing cover relative to the battery holder. The first plurality of magnets in the housing cover is repelled from the second plurality of magnets in a second position of the housing cover relative to the battery holder. The first position and the second position share a rotational axis normal to the touch-enabled surface.
    Type: Application
    Filed: November 8, 2012
    Publication date: July 11, 2013
    Applicant: Fanhattan LLC
    Inventor: Fanhattan LLC
  • Publication number: 20130179796
    Abstract: A method and system for navigating a user interface using a touch-enabled remote control device are disclosed. A focus element is provided in a first portion of a user interface of an application executing on a client device. The focus element visually emphasizes a user interface element from a first plurality of media content. Input data transmitted from a remote control device are received. The remote control device has a touch-enabled surface by which the input data is detected. In response to receiving the input data corresponding a horizontal swipe, a lateral movement of the first plurality of media content is caused in the first portion of a user interface. In response to receiving the input data corresponding a vertical swipe, a shift movement of a second plurality of media content is caused in a second portion of the user interface to the first portion of the user interface.
    Type: Application
    Filed: January 8, 2013
    Publication date: July 11, 2013
    Applicant: Fanhattan LLC
    Inventor: Fanhattan LLC
  • Patent number: 8484244
    Abstract: In a method and system for forecasting an availability of content, a selection of a media content item is received. Metadata related to the selected media content item is retrieved from a database record corresponding to the media content item. The metadata includes release data for a release window associated with the media content item. Based on the release data indicating the media content item has been released in the release window, an actual release date for the release window is presented to the client device. Based on the release data indicating the media content item has not been released in the release window, an estimated release date and a confidence indicator for the estimated release date for the release window are generated using the retrieved metadata and presented to the client device.
    Type: Grant
    Filed: December 17, 2010
    Date of Patent: July 9, 2013
    Assignee: Fanhattan LLC
    Inventors: Christophe Gillet, Jorge Reyna
  • Patent number: 8335801
    Abstract: In a method and system for matching content between content sources, a first set of metadata describing a first content item is compared to a second set of metadata describing a second content item. Based on the comparing, an accuracy score is generated. The accuracy score indicates an amount of similarity between the first set of metadata and the second set of metadata. The accuracy score is compared to a predetermined accuracy threshold value. Based on the accuracy score being greater than or equal to the predetermined accuracy threshold value, a determination is made that the first content item and the second content item are a match. Based on the accuracy score being less than the predetermined accuracy threshold value, a determination is made that the first content item and the second content item are not a match.
    Type: Grant
    Filed: December 17, 2010
    Date of Patent: December 18, 2012
    Assignee: Fanhattan LLC
    Inventors: Paul Anton Richardson Gardner, Olivier Chalouhi
  • Publication number: 20120311453
    Abstract: A first selection of an aggregated content category is received from a plurality of aggregated content categories provided in a first portion of a user interface for an application for browsing and viewing media content. A second portion of the user interface is populated with media content items categorized in the selected aggregated content category. A second selection of a media content item of the media content items categorized in the selected aggregated category is received. The user interface is populated with user interface panels relating to aspects of the selected media content item. The user interface panels have a content item description panel, a cast panel, a content source panel, a reviews panel, a connect panel, and a news feed panel.
    Type: Application
    Filed: May 31, 2012
    Publication date: December 6, 2012
    Applicant: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Keith Ohlfs
  • Publication number: 20120311070
    Abstract: In a method and system for accessing content, a type of device executing an application configured to access a plurality of content items is detected. The application aggregates for each content item at least one content source from which the content item may be accessed. A selection of a content item from a plurality of content items is received. A request for the content item is transmitted to a content source of the at least one content source. The request specifies a priority ordering of encoding schemes for the content item that is based on the type of device executing the application. The content item is received from the content source. The content item has an encoding scheme selected from the priority ordering of the encoding schemes.
    Type: Application
    Filed: May 31, 2011
    Publication date: December 6, 2012
    Applicant: FANHATTAN LLC
    Inventors: Gilles Serge BianRosa, Olivier Chalouhi, Christophe Jean-Claude Gillet, Keith Ohlfs
  • Publication number: 20120311440
    Abstract: In a method and system for navigating content, a plurality of content filter panels are provided in a user interface of an application for browsing and viewing media content. The content filter panels each contain at least one selectable filter for filtering media content items. A direction of movement of a navigation indicator within an active content filter panel is determined, with the navigation indicator being controlled by a user. Based on a determination of a movement direction of the navigation indicator in a first axis, the active content filter panel is switched from a first content filter panel to a second content filter panel. Based on a determination of a movement direction of the navigation indicator in a second axis, the media content items are filtered according to a selectable filter of the active content filter panel selected by the navigation indicator. At least one of the filtered media content items is caused to be displayed in the user interface.
    Type: Application
    Filed: May 31, 2011
    Publication date: December 6, 2012
    Applicant: FANHATTAN L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Olivier Chalouhi, Keith Ohlfs
  • Publication number: 20120311481
    Abstract: In a method and system for navigating content, a selection of a content item is received in an application for browsing and viewing media content. Metadata related to the selected content item is retrieved. A plurality of user interface panels is generated in a user interface, with each user interface panel being related to an aspect of the selected content item. Each user interface panel is populated with correspondingly relevant metadata of the retrieved metadata. A selection of a metadata item is received in one of the plurality of user interface panels. Media content is thus browsable by iteratively repeating the steps of retrieving, the generating, the populating, and the receiving of the selection of the metadata item.
    Type: Application
    Filed: May 31, 2011
    Publication date: December 6, 2012
    Applicant: FANHATTAN L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Keith Ohlfs
  • Publication number: 20120311502
    Abstract: In a system and method for navigating content, a first selection of an aggregated content category is received from a plurality of aggregated content categories provided in a first portion of a user interface for an application for browsing and viewing media content. A second portion of the user interface is populated with media content items categorized in the selected aggregated content category. A second selection of a media content item of the media content items categorized in the selected aggregated category is received. The media content items are shifted to the first portion of the user interface, and the second portion of the user interface is populated with user interface panels relating to aspects of the selected media content item. A third selection of an indicator to view the aspects of the selected media content item is received. The user interface is regenerated to cause the display of only the user interface panels.
    Type: Application
    Filed: May 31, 2011
    Publication date: December 6, 2012
    Applicant: FANHATTAN L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Keith Ohlfs
  • Publication number: 20120311486
    Abstract: In a method and system for navigating content, a plurality of content panels are provided for display in a user interface region of a display area. User input corresponding to a direction of navigation within the first user interface is received. A first direction of navigation causes a movement in the plurality of content panels displayed in the user interface region. A second direction of navigation causes a transition from a first user interface region to a second user interface region, resulting in at least a portion of the first user interface region shifting out of the display area and at least a portion of the second user interface region shifting into the display area.
    Type: Application
    Filed: October 17, 2011
    Publication date: December 6, 2012
    Applicant: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Olivier Chalouhi, Keith Ohlfs
  • Publication number: 20120311441
    Abstract: In a system and method for navigating content, a user interface panel is generated in a user interface for an application for browsing and viewing media content. The user interface panel includes a first sub-panel and a second sub-panel. The first sub-panel includes a plurality of filter categories, while the second sub-panel includes filter options for a selected filter category. In response to a selection of at least one filter category and at least one filter option for each of the selected filter categories, a set of media content items satisfying the at least one filter option for each of the selected filter categories is caused to be displayed in the user interface.
    Type: Application
    Filed: May 31, 2011
    Publication date: December 6, 2012
    Applicant: FANHATTAN LLC
    Inventors: Jorge Fernando Reyna, Gilles Serge BianRosa, Keith Ohlfs
  • Patent number: D672363
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: December 11, 2012
    Assignee: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Christophe Jean-Claude Gillet, Gilles Serge BianRosa, Keith Ohlfs
  • Patent number: D672364
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: December 11, 2012
    Assignee: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Christophe Jean-Claude Gillet, Gilles Serge BianRosa, Keith Ohlfs
  • Patent number: D677686
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: March 12, 2013
    Assignee: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Christophe Jean-Claude Gillet, Gilles Serge BianRosa, Keith Ohlfs
  • Patent number: D678311
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: March 19, 2013
    Assignee: Fanhattan, LLC
    Inventors: Jorge Fernando Reyna, Christophe Jean-Claude Gillet, Gilles Serge BianRosa, Keith Ohlfs
  • Patent number: D689064
    Type: Grant
    Filed: May 31, 2011
    Date of Patent: September 3, 2013
    Assignee: Fanhattan LLC
    Inventors: Jorge Fernando Reyna, Christophe Jean-Claude Gillet, Gilles Serge BianRosa, Keith Ohlfs